Output cec6ee15988e53b6461fa92d217f7ad86e88b1f12c83cf53d9082f32ea4b626c:1

value
1529840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66ec6c0768afe22eaa2d905a49ea3bb40c2242a OP_EQUAL
address
3QA2rcRBxZkyYEEWXWKgPDSLvHgANDsC7m
transaction
cec6ee15988e53b6461fa92d217f7ad86e88b1f12c83cf53d9082f32ea4b626c
spent
true